Ok this isint a 700 but its close and i need help.

I took the carb off and i found out it has 2 different size mains in it. is this suppose to be?

anywhoo

what jets should i run with a slip on pipe and a intake?

i have in it currently.

155 main on the left side, 160 main on the right

25 pilot in both sides

needle on the middle clip.

help?

i think the pilot is off becaus this thing starts like a DOG, should i go up or down on the pilot? it also backfires quite a bit when you go in 5th and let off the throttle.

im thinking of going down on the pilot one? good idea or not?

I used to have a 660 before my yfz and it was a pain in the ***** to jet. The right carb should have one size bigger jet than the left side. I think I was running about the same jets that you are. If it is backfiring on decel than you need to bump up the pilot one size, this could also be the reason that it is a pain to start. Mine fired right up but I can't remember what size pilot I was running, I think it was a 27.5. If you go down on the pilot than it is gonna be running more lean than it is now and probably backfire more. Try that and let me know how it works for ya.
